|
...
|
...
|
@@ -28,7 +28,7 @@ class GeoController extends BaseController |
|
|
|
public function getWritingsList(Request $request)
|
|
|
|
{
|
|
|
|
try {
|
|
|
|
$token = trim($request->input('token'));
|
|
|
|
$token = trim($this->param['token']);
|
|
|
|
$param = Crypt::decrypt($token);
|
|
|
|
if ($param['send_at'] + 86400 < time()) {}
|
|
|
|
$project_id = $param['project_id'];
|
|
...
|
...
|
@@ -78,10 +78,14 @@ class GeoController extends BaseController |
|
|
|
]);
|
|
|
|
$token = trim($request->input('token'));
|
|
|
|
$data = GeoWritings::where(['uniqid' => $token])->first();
|
|
|
|
if (empty($data))
|
|
|
|
if (empty($data)){
|
|
|
|
return $this->error('非法请求');
|
|
|
|
if ($data->status != GeoWritings::STATUS_RUNNING)
|
|
|
|
}
|
|
|
|
|
|
|
|
if ($data->status != GeoWritings::STATUS_RUNNING){
|
|
|
|
return $this->error('当前文章已确认,不可再次确认');
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
// FIXME 验证完成,保存数据,计算内容长度,处理内容中的资源, IP 确认时间 状态
|
|
|
|
return $data;
|
...
|
...
|
|